FBCG vs SPHQ: how they differ
FBCG and SPHQ hold 11% of their weight in the same names.
Fidelity Blue Chip Growth ETF and Invesco S&P 500 Quality ETF.
What they hold in common
By the books each fund has filed, FBCG and SPHQ hold 11% of their money in the same securities at the same weight.

Weight overlap is an ETFIQ calculation: for every security both funds hold, the smaller of the two weights, summed. Above 50%, holding both is close to holding one of them twice. Holdings dated Apr 30, 2026.

FBCG in plain words
FBCG is an index equity fund tracking the Blue Chip Growth. Over the year to Sep 11, 2026 it returned +17.3% with distributions reinvested, against +17.5% for the S&P 500 and +23.0% for the Nasdaq-100. The prospectus expense ratio is 0.57% a year. By its holdings filed for Apr 30, 2026, 87% of the fund by weight is stocks the S&P 500 also holds, across 214 positions, with the top ten at 61.2%. It sat 3.7% below its high of Jun 2, 2026 on Sep 11, 2026.
SPHQ in plain words
SPHQ is an index equity fund tracking the S&P 500 Quality. Over the year to Sep 11, 2026 it returned +17.4% with distributions reinvested, against +17.5% for the S&P 500 and +23.0% for the Nasdaq-100. The prospectus expense ratio is 0.15% a year. By its holdings filed for Apr 30, 2026, 100% of the fund by weight is stocks the S&P 500 also holds, across 99 positions, with the top ten at 40.7%. It sat 6.1% below its high of Jun 30, 2026 on Sep 11, 2026.
